the dry cleaning fee for 3 pairs of pants is $18. what is the constant of proportionality. How much will the dry cleaner charge

for 11 pairs of pants?

Answer:

Constant of proportionality is $6 for one pair and cost of dry cleaning 11 pairs of pants is $66.

Step-by-step explanation:

Dry cleaning fees is directly proportional to the charges of dry cleaning.

Cleaning fee ∝ Pairs of pants

Cleaning fee = k × Pairs of pants

where k is the proportionality constant.

If dry cleaning fee for 3 pairs of pants is $18 then from the equation given above

18 = k ×3

k = \frac{18}{3}=6

SO the equation will be Cleaning fees = 6×Pairs of pants

For 11 pairs of pants,

Cleaning fees = 6×11 = $66

Therefore, constant of proportionality is $6 for one pair of pants and cost of dry cleaning 11 pairs of pants is $66.

When was the last time that texas tried to become its own state
Rudik [331]

Answer:

The Texas Declaration of Independence was signed in 1836 and the Texas Republic ratified its own constitution shortly after. In 1837, the U.S. formally recognized Texas as a nation, but the new country struggled economically without any of the resources of its larger neighbors, leading most (but not all) residents to welcome statehood by the time it came through in 1845. Only a little more than a decade passed, however, before the state tried to secede from its national government again, joining with the Confederacy in 1861.
